Twelve growing buffalo calves with an average weight of 121.7 Kg were divided randomly into three similar groups (four animals each). Each group was assigned randomly to one of the following three dietary treatments: Control ration C (70% concentrate feed mixture CFM+30% rice straw), fodder beet ration. FB (52.5% CFM+17.5 fodder beet+30% rice straw} and fodder beet silage ration, FBS (52,5'10 CFM+17.5 fodder beet silage +30% rice straw) on DM basis. The experiment was extended for 90 days.
